Common Types of Window Issues
A number of types of problems can be experienced with windows. Understanding these issues can assist property owners determine when it is time to employ repair services.
Kind of IssueDescriptionFractures and ChipsSmall fractures or breaks in the glass that can aggravate gradually.Fogging Between PanesWetness caught between double or triple-pane windows.Frame DamageWear and tear or breakage of the window frame due to age or weather condition.Malfunctioning HardwareProblems with locks, hinges, or manages that prevent windows from working correctly.InefficiencyPoor insulation causing higher energy costs.Window Repair Techniques
Window repair services can use various methods depending upon the problem at hand. Below are some common approaches utilized to attend to window issues:
Glass Replacement
For split or broken glass, specialists may require to replace the whole pane.
Resealing Windows
For foggy windows, professionals can reseal the window to eliminate wetness buildup.
Frame Repair
This might include replacing decomposed wood, enhancing the frame, or repainting it for protection.
Hardware Installation or Adjustment
Changing or repairing locks, deals with, and hinges to make sure windows run efficiently.
Weatherstripping
Installing weatherstripping or caulking to improve energy performance and prevent drafts.Factors Influencing Repair Costs

While it's impossible to prevent all window problems, regular maintenance can reduce the possibility and frequency of repairs. Here are some practical ideas:
Inspect Regularly: Check for any fractures, moisture accumulation, or frame wear and tear at least two times a year.Clean Frames and Glass: Regular cleaning can avoid damage brought on by dirt and grime. Use suitable cleaners for both glass and frames.Check Seals: Periodically check sealants for wear and tear, and change them if essential to prevent moisture intrusion.Oil Hardware: Keeping locks, hinges, and moving mechanisms lubed can avoid rust and make sure easy operation.Think about Upgrades: If windows are old and regularly need repairs, consider changing them with energy-efficient designs.FAQs About Window Repair Services
1. How do I know if my windows need repair?Indications include visible cracks or chips, misting glass, trouble in opening or closing windows, and noticeable drafts.
2. Can I repair my windows myself?While minor concerns like cleaning or caulking can be DIY, significant damage or complex repair work are best dealt with by specialists.
3. What is the average cost of window repair?The cost can differ commonly depending upon the kind of repair required; nevertheless, it usually ranges from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 per window.
4. What should I do after a window has been repaired?Ensure to keep track of the window for any repeating problems and follow regular maintenance pointers to extend its lifespan.
5. Are there service warranties on window repairs?Lots of window repair services use warranties on their work; it's a good idea to ask about this when working with a professional.
